ATD & UT Center for Transportation Research organized and executed the logistics for this event. In alignment with Open Data Day, ATD released a host of bluetooth sensor traffic data. They also encouraged participants to create low cost sensors. I want to highlight this quote with one of the organizers that I 100% agree with:
“It’s about building a relationship between the public and government in a new way, a technological way,” Clary said. “Smart cities aren’t just about buying technology. To me being a smart city means making the most of the resources that we have.”
